Will the ceiling light strip accumulate dust?

1. Color selection

You can choose monochrome light strips or colorful RGB light strips according to the actual style of the room. If you want a richer effect, it is recommended to use colorful LED light strips.

2. Voltage selection

If you consider convenience, you will generally choose high-voltage light strips, which are cut into 1-meter pieces. You can cut as many meters as you need. For safety reasons, it is not recommended that users clean the ceiling grooves. It is recommended that users choose weak-current LED soft light strips (5v, 12v, 24v are all acceptable).

3. Choice of waterproof grade

In dry indoor environments, IP20 bare board light strips can be used, but bare board light strips are inconvenient to clean. For relatively humid ceiling decorations, it is recommended to use drip-glue sleeves or sleeve-filled light strips, which are perfect in terms of safety, practicality, and convenience.

What kind of ceiling lamp is good?

What kind of ceiling lamp is good cannot be generalized. It depends on the indoor space area, height, decoration style, main color, and personal preference.

The height determines whether to use a ceiling-mounted or suspended type, and the space area determines the size of the lamp. At the same time, the lamp type and the brightness and softness of the light should be matched and coordinated with the decoration style and main color, so that it can reflect natural beauty, good coordination, and comfortable living.

The suspended ceiling will be combined with the lamps for one installation, and the suspended ceiling is suitable for installing various lamps, such as ceiling lamps, chandeliers, downlights, and spotlights can be installed on the ceiling.

The downlight is hidden in the ceiling, and it is necessary to reserve a space for the downlight in front of the ceiling to facilitate later installation.

Ceiling lamps and chandeliers are generally fixed inside the ceiling, so when installing the ceiling, you should also reserve positions for the lamp holes of the chandeliers and ceiling lamps. This will facilitate the later wiring and reduce a lot of trouble for the installation of lamps in the future. There will be some overlap on the ceiling.

The overlapping parts can hide some light strips, because the light strips can make the light in the interior space more layered and soft, thus making the lighting of the entire space more diverse.
